Ladies Senior League Division 1
Clann na nGael 2-11 Padraig Pearses 2-7
Clann got their league campaign off to a good start with a good win over Padraig Pearses on Friday last in Johnstown.The team played some promising football but for some poor finishing and wayward final passes, they could have wrapped the match up long before the final whistle. Instead there were nervous moments near the end after Steffi Carthy pulled a late goal back for Pearses. The scores were level at the break after some good scores from Tracey Keegan, Blana Gately, Maz Sweeney, Kathleen Doran-Rourke and Kim Finlass. An early second half point from Michelle Harney-Nolan was soon followed by a goal from Kathleen Doran-Rourke on 4 minutes. Two more points from Blana Gately and a goal from Maz Sweeney, after being set up by Michelle Keegan, put Clann in the driving seat. Clann had two more points from Maz Sweeney and Kathleen Doran-Rourke before Pearses late rally.
